SANTA RITA, Guam (April 19, 2021) Mineman 2nd Class Brandon J. Marco, from Las Vegas, assigned to Independence-variant littoral combat ship USS Tulsa (LCS 16), signals to his crew after jumping off a rigid-hull inflatable boat during a search and rescue drill. Tulsa is currently operating as part of U.S. 3rd Fleet.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ist 2nd Class Colby A. Mothershead)
